Comparison of adsorption capacities of various adsorbents for 2,4-D pesticide removal.

Adsorbent Adsorption capacity (mg g−1) Reference
Granular activated carbon 27.1 19
Rice husk Biochar 24.6 19
Multi-walled carbon nanotubes 21.9 19
Granular activated carbon 182 20
MIEX resin 47 21
Magnetic ion-exchange resin 61 22
Physalisperuviana chalice 244 30
UiO-66-NMe3+ 279 32
Corn cob biochar 37.4 35
Polypyrrole-Fe3O4 magnetic NPs 96.1 41
Magnetic graphene 32 42
Neemoil–phenolic resin treated lignocellulosic jute 39 43
H3PO4-activated carbon 261 44
SBA-15 templated carbon C100 136 45
Chitosan 11 46
Biochar from Switch grass (Panicumvirgatum) 133 47
Amino-functionalized poly (glycidyl methacrylate) 99.4 48
Graphene oxide coated with porous iron oxide ribbons 67.2 49
Oil palm frond activated carbon 45.0 50
Metal hydroxides 42.1 51
DEAE-cellulose 429.8 Present study
